Follow these steps when:
- Processing failed for uploaded media.
- You are unable to upload files or share recordings.
- You see the following error messages in the editor:
- "You've reached the max amount of files you can upload. Remove one to add a new file."
- "An error occurred, please try again later."
Likely causes:
Being unable to upload files to the editor could be a result of an unverified email account, an unsupported file type, or hitting the maximum upload limit.
Suggested troubleshooting steps
- Verify your Riverside email:
- Check your email for a message from notifications@riverside.fm with the subject Verify your new email address:
- Open the email and click Verify email address.
- Ensure the file you’re trying to upload is in a supported format.
- When you upload media files directly to the editor, you can add up to 20 files of 100 MB each to the Your media folder. To add more than 20 files to an edit, upload the new media to your studio dashboard. Then, add that media to the timeline by selecting Recordings.
